IPL Phototherapy

IPL (Intense Pulsed Light) Phototherapy is a non-invasive,
multi-functional light treatment designed to improve overall skin quality.

This procedure is ideal for patients who want clear, even, healthy-looking skin without makeup.

IPL works on pigmentation, redness, vascular changes, acne-prone skin, enlarged pores, and early signs of photoaging — all without damaging the surface of the skin or requiring recovery time.

Multi-spectrum rejuvenation in minutes

How IPL Phototherapy revitalises skin

IPL technology works by delivering flashes of light that are absorbed by specific chromophores in the skin and transformed into heat. By adjusting wavelengths, we work on different skin layers:

This multi-layered approach allows IPL to treat multiple skin concerns simultaneously, without damaging the epidermis. IPL is particularly effective for photodamaged skin, uneven tone and pigmentation, redness and rosacea, enlarged pores, acne and post-acne marks

For enhanced and longer-lasting results, IPL is often combined with Skin boosters with Amino acids, PRP, Microneedling (Dermapen). The treatment is suitable for the face, neck, and décolleté.

Before Treatment Instructions

Before your session

  • Avoid tanning and self-tan products for two weeks prior.
  • Pause retinoids and exfoliants 5 days before treatment.
  • Arrive with clean skin free from makeup and SPF.

Post Treatment Instructions

  1. Cleanse with a gentle, non-active formula morning and evening.
  2. Hydrate with antioxidant serums to support collagen renewal.
  3. Wear broad-spectrum SPF 50 and reapply every 2 hours outdoors.
  4. Schedule maintenance sessions every 6–12 months.

IPL Phototherapy essentials

Is IPL suitable for all skin types?

IPL is suitable for most skin types, except very dark skin tones (Fitzpatrick V–VI), where the risk of pigmentation changes is higher. A consultation is essential to assess suitability.

How many sessions do I need?

The number of sessions depends on your skin condition, concerns, and age. On average, 4–6 sessions are recommended for visible and stable improvement. This is always discussed during consultation.

Can I combine IPL with other treatments?

Yes. IPL combines very well with skin boosters, mesotherapy, PRP, vitamin C treatments, Dermapen. Combination protocols significantly enhance results.

Is there any downtime after IPL?

No. IPL is a non-invasive procedure with no skin damage. You can return to work and social activities immediately.

When can I apply makeup and exercise?

Makeup can be applied the same day, and light exercise is allowed. The main restriction is sun exposure — daily SPF is mandatory, and direct sun should be avoided during the treatment course.

Is IPL painful?

Most patients describe the sensation as mild warmth or light snapping. The treatment is well tolerated thanks to integrated cooling systems.
